Im not saying is it easy to fill out the forms ...

What I would like to ask is: after I submit certain forms i.e. recomendations, activities record, transcript...How difficult is it to change that?

for example:

I would like my whole form done by Sep. 1st for the start of the rolling admissions, However, I am currently working on my Eagle project and Definately wont finish by then. I am also expecting to get accepted into NHS this year.

So would it be wise to fill out everything now, and then update it later as it comes along? How exactly would I update later?

thank you in advance for taking to time to read my question
 
It's not difficult at all...biggest thing is keeping your BGO informed in any changes and when you send stuff into USNA. they can help track stuff as they will see when USNA receives the required paperwork. also the BGO can make student notes in the file they have on you and this is also looked at when the board looks at your record.
 
In recent years the general prudential rule has been to complete and submit your packet as early as possible then update the information as warranted throughout the year; eg, latest semester grades, any awards received, etc. The early look is becoming increasingly important to candidates, especially if they are in highly competitive states or districts - so my recommendation to candidates would be to get started now and submit as soon as you are confident that the section is complete and accurate.
